Types of Truss Head Wood Screws

Truss head wood screws are available in various types, each designed to serve a specific purpose. One of the most common types is the coarse-thread truss head wood screw, which is ideal for use in softwoods and thicker materials. The coarse threads provide a strong grip, making it easier to drive the screw into the wood. On the other hand, fine-thread truss head wood screws are better suited for hardwoods and thinner materials, as they provide a smoother drive and reduce the risk of splitting the wood. Installation and Removal of Truss Head Wood Screws

Installing truss head wood screws is a relatively simple process that requires a few basic tools. The first step is to choose the right screw for the job, taking into account the type of material, the thickness of the material, and the desired length and gauge of the screw. Once you’ve selected the right screw, you can begin the installation process.
To install a truss head wood screw, start by drilling a pilot hole into the material. The pilot hole should be slightly smaller than the screw, and it should be centered on the mark where you want to place the screw. Next, insert the screw into the pilot hole and begin to drive it into the material using a screwdriver or drill. Apply gentle to moderate pressure, depending on the type of material and the desired depth of the screw.
As you drive the screw, make sure it’s straight and level. You can use a level or a straightedge to ensure the screw is properly aligned. If you’re using a drill, make sure to keep the drill bit straight and level, as this will help prevent the screw from stripping or splitting the material.

Material and Coating

The material and coating of truss head wood screws play a crucial role in their durability and performance. Screws made from high-quality steel or stainless steel are more resistant to corrosion and can withstand harsh environmental conditions. Additionally, a protective coating such as zinc or galvanization can further enhance the screw’s resistance to rust and corrosion. When choosing truss head wood screws, it is essential to consider the type of material and coating that suits your project’s requirements. For example, if you are working on an outdoor project, stainless steel screws with a galvanized coating would be an excellent choice.

The type of coating can also affect the screw’s ability to withstand extreme temperatures and moisture. For instance, screws with a zinc coating can provide excellent corrosion resistance, but may not be suitable for high-temperature applications. On the other hand, screws with a ceramic coating can withstand high temperatures, but may not provide the same level of corrosion resistance. By understanding the different types of materials and coatings available, you can select the best truss head wood screws that meet your project’s specific needs and ensure a secure and durable hold in wood.

Drive Type

The drive type of truss head wood screws is another critical factor to consider, as it affects the screw’s ability to be easily driven into wood. There are several types of drive types available, including Phillips, flathead, and square. Each drive type has its own advantages and disadvantages, and the right choice will depend on your project’s specific requirements. When choosing truss head wood screws, it is essential to consider the type of drive that suits your project’s needs.

The drive type can also impact the screw’s ability to withstand cam-out and stripping. For example, screws with a Phillips drive can provide a secure hold in wood, but may be prone to cam-out and stripping if over-torqued. On the other hand, screws with a square drive can provide a more secure hold in wood and are less prone to cam-out and stripping. By selecting the right drive type, you can ensure that your truss head wood screws are easy to drive into wood and provide a secure and durable hold.
